The uptake of water by a plant increases if a fan blows air over the leaves. This is because:
If a fan blows air over the leaves, the uptake of water by a plant increases because diffusion is faster when the diffusion gradient is greatest.
1 of 5
The loss of water vapour from leaves slows down if the plant is put into a plastic bag. This is because:
If the plant is put into a plastic bag, the loss of water vapour from leaves slows down because the humidity increases.
2 of 5
Sugars made in leaf cells are transported to flower buds by:
Sugars made in leaf cells are transported to flower buds by phloem.
3 of 5
The wood in tree trunks is mostly a collection of:
The wood in tree trunks is mostly a collection of xylum cells.
4 of 5
In plant roots how are the xylem and phloem aranged?
The xlyem and phloem are arranged in the centre of the root to withstand stretching forces.
